Topless Night & Kids Bicycle Blowout Night @ Highland Speedway Saturday, August 17th!

HIghland SpeedwayCome out and join us Saturday, August 17th for Topless Night & Kids Bicycle Blowout Night! See who will take their top off; it is going to be a great night of racing action!!!! It is going to be a fun filled night with the Annual Kids Bicycle Blowout. Some lucky Junior Fan Club Members will be going home with brand new bicycles. We will be running UMP Late Models, UMP Steve Schmitt Modifieds, UMP Miller Lite Crates, UMP B-Dry Solutions SportMods, & UMP Hamel Coop Street Stocks!!!! It is Double Down Night for the UMP Miller Lite Crates! Come out and see who will make it to the CC Food Mart Victory Lane!! The Pick 3 rolled over and is up to $400, last time we had a $300 Pick 3 jackpot two people split it. Come out for your chance to win!

Pits Open at 3:00 pm, Grandstands Open at 5:30 pm, Pill Draw by 6:00 pm, Drivers Meeting at 6:15 pm, Hot Laps at 6:30 pm, and Racing starts at 7:00 pm. Box Seats are $15.00, General Grandstand Admission is $12.00, kids 10 and under are free with a paid adult admission. Pit Passes are $30.00 and pit passes for kids 10 and under are $15.00 (Kids in the pits must have parental supervision at all times.)

The Highland Speedway is looking for Bicycle or monetary donations for the annual Bicycle Blowout. Any fans, teams, drivers, businesses, or individuals that would like to donate towards this event please contact Track Manager, Sue Zobrist with your monetary pledge or donation, so we will know how many bicycles that we can purchase. Or if you would like to donate a bicycle, please bring it to the Pit Shack or Ticket Booth on Saturday. The Junior Fan Club appreciates all of your donations and thanks you for your support. This is a great event and the kids love it!

The Huddle House is proud to present this seasons Pick 3 Contest. Last week the Pick 3 rolled over with no winner. Don’t forget to get your Pick 3 ticket with your paid adult grandstand admission. Guess the winners of the 3 chosen Features at Highland Speedway during the night. Turn in your guess to the grandstand gate before the dashes start. If you pick the correct 3 winners, you have a chance to win part or the entire $400 jackpot. If there are more than one correct guesses, money will be split between all the correct guesses. If there are more than 10 correct winners, one winner will be chosen randomly for the entire jackpot. If no one guesses correctly, the money will roll over until a winner is correct.
